Zona Blue is a Brazilian band that formed around 2010, with Roberta Campos on lead vocals and songwriting, Pedro Guedes on guitar and vocals, Bernardo Fonseca on bass, and Fábio Almeida on drums. Their first album, Zona Azul, came out in 2010, followed by several others including Oco in 2012, Bipolar in 2014, and Amante in 2016.
Their song 'Abrigo' became particularly well-known, with Campos's vocals carrying its melodic lines. The band's sound mixes indie pop and alternative rock elements, leaning toward atmospheric arrangements.
They released Meridiano in 2018 and Transborda in 2021. The group faced some criticism early on for their unconventional approach, and original bassist Gabriel Guerra left at some point, but they continued recording with the lineup that included Fonseca.
